Five-try Bath dominate Gloucester to top Prem
Bath's impressive performance secured a bonus point victory over Gloucester, allowing them to rise to the top of the Premiership table. Despite a spirited second-half comeback from Gloucester, Bath's dominance in the match showcased their strength and determination, making this win significant as it positions them favorably in the league.

Texas beats No. 6 Oklahoma 23-6 in Red River Rivalry after falling from preseason No. 1 to unranked in the AP Top 25
PositiveSports
In a thrilling showdown, Texas triumphed over No. 6 Oklahoma with a score of 23-6 in the Red River Rivalry. This victory is particularly significant as Texas had recently dropped from the preseason No. 1 ranking to being unranked in the AP Top 25. The win not only boosts Texas's confidence but also re-establishes their competitive edge in college football, making them a team to watch as the season progresses.
